I suggest to avoid centralized exchange like kraken or bittrex at all!
It's better if you start using decentralized exchanges which are usually safer, more reliable and above all has no power to block your funds or ask you for further verifications. The downside is that decentralized exchanges are often difficult to use for newbies and have lower volumes. A good choice I suggest you is Waves decentralized exchange, which is fast, safe, cheap and very user-friendly too!
